Poetry Writing – Blackout Poetry
May 13 @ 5:00 pm - 6:30 pm
We’ll discuss how word choice can make or break a poem. See examples from poems that demonstrate impactful writing, such as Letter to the Person Who Carved His Initials into the Oldest Living Longleaf Pine in North America by Matthew Olzmann, Two-Headed Calf by Laura Gilpin, and The Death of the Ball Turret Gunner by Randall Jarrell. Then join in an open discussion about how the authors’ word choice impacts the poem. Young folks be given a prompt and art supplies to create their own blackout poetry.
